With the upcoming issue #1000 on the bugtracker, I thought maybe we could set it up as a symbolic milestone.

For reference there was ubuntu's bug #1 entitled "Microsoft has a majority market share" which was marked as fixed a few months ago due to the spread of android.
Inspired by that bug there's also wine's bug #10000 "The original win32 api implementation is still more popular than wine."

On that mindset we could set up bug #1000 as "Morrowind.exe is still the dominant game engine implementation for experiencing the Morrowind World" or something along those lines.
I'm aware that it would not count as an actual bug impacting game performance and that it would probably impossible to measure but I think it would stand as a interesting symbolic milestone, and could probably bring some publicity.

So, what's everyone's thoughts on this?

Ok, here's the description of the bug I came up with. Hopefully it's not overly verbose and poetic. I'm open to suggestions:
Title: Bethesda's Morrowind is still predominantly played with its original engine

Morrowind is a great game to play and a beautiful world to experience. And through the years, modders have expanded it to every imaginable direction. The last piece of the game that remained static, since it's pretty hard to alter, is the game engine. It is a piece of software built on decade old technology, that runs on only one OS, has a long list of known bugs and has held back the capabilities of modders since the game's release.

It's our vision, that Morrowind could be so much more with a new, living engine that would reinvigorate and immortalize the game and give creators all the tools they need to materialize their visions.

For this reason, we set the goal of building an alternative engine that is so good that most Morrowind players in the future will prefer it as the default vessel to experience the Morrowind world.


This issue drew inspiration from the following bugs:
